Output 23ef72d21e8d8f18ea8ac43f7170235c15f5136bbd7399c1808e99d5b3e69991:1

value
8500065055
script pubkey
OP_0 OP_PUSHBYTES_20 8390113ada9e5ef9bba29e06971b5ae39181453c
address
tb1qswgpzwk6ne00nwazncrfwx66uwgcz3fusvs6qs
transaction
23ef72d21e8d8f18ea8ac43f7170235c15f5136bbd7399c1808e99d5b3e69991